Answer

ProteoWizard software, version 3.0.20258-97f41f698, can convert many vendor-encrypted data files, including those from Agilent, Bruker, Mascot, SCIEX, Shimadzu, Thermo, and Waters. Files in the format MGF, mzML and mzXML can also be interconverted. (The SCIEX data file formats include wiff, wiff2 and t2d files, and are convertible on ProteoWizard.)

This newest version of ProteoWizard software can now convert data files to the txt format, as well as the three original file types (MGF, mzML and mzXML). For SCIEX software users, the txt file might be a useful option; however, the quality of the output file from ProteoWizard has not tested.
